Output 976033b8b2e9249b5ee84107f3ebe5ba3aab6679489867f487aa27b6a9b7446a:17

value
16072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10186d8de5eafea753402590f91660c646c67e9b OP_EQUAL
address
33A7ztx8T9SVQXWHat4wEhNyweAk7A2Y1n
transaction
976033b8b2e9249b5ee84107f3ebe5ba3aab6679489867f487aa27b6a9b7446a